Xero’s Connected Workplaces division offers several products that support small businesses, and one of these products is Xero Payroll. This product is the critical foundation for the Connected Workplaces platform, is a significant revenue driver to the business, and is already available across AU, UK and NZ, with a new product in development for Canada and the strategy for the US currently in review.
